Output f2a9237681be62b322e851c123f27b8e5811ce99bc7a45b7e945c2dbb421a0d9:3

value
2406889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ec23cea50355bf3092b0cf234b433051302c1a1 OP_EQUAL
address
38sTKPv7PaDnVENuHi7aqRLPLy7Kq3Ktrx
transaction
f2a9237681be62b322e851c123f27b8e5811ce99bc7a45b7e945c2dbb421a0d9
spent
true